#1bdef8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1bdef8 is composed of 10.6% red, 87.1% green and 97.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.1% cyan, 10.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 187.1 degrees, a saturation of 94% and a lightness of 53.9%. #1bdef8 color hex could be obtained by blending #36ffff with #00bdf1. Closest websafe color is: #33ccff.

#1bdef8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1bdef8 has RGB values of R:27, G:222, B:248 and CMYK values of C:0.89, M:0.1, Y:0,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 1826552.

Shades and Tints of #1bdef8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#ecfcfe is the lightest one.
